What you'll learn
Understand environmental factors that affect the strength and stiffness of materials over time.
Identify different types of material decay such as moisture damage, corrosion, and ultraviolet degradation.
Learn how maintenance, protective treatments, and material choice influence the lifespan of structures.see more
